David has specialised for many years in serious crime, both prosecuting and defending in many high profile cases of murder (both as Junior and Leading Junior), manslaughter and GBH, rape and other serious sexual assaults including historic sexual abuse of adults and children, Class A and B drug conspiracy, and high value fraud and deception.
David was a Grade 4 Crown Prosecutor for in excess of 15 years and is now included on the CPS Advocate Panel for general crime at level 4 and in on the CPS Advocate Panel rape list.
David was appointed as an Assistant Recorder in 1998 and as a Recorder in 2000, and sits regularly in the Crown and County Courts throughout the North Eastern Circuit in Crime, Civil and Private Family Law.
